Petr Cech believes the positive impact of Eden Hazard and Oscar has helped Chelsea dramatically change their style in the early weeks of the season.

Chelsea goalkeeper Petr Cech has hailed the performances of new signings Eden Hazard and Oscar in the early weeks of the season.

Hazard and Oscar have shone to help guide Chelsea to the top of the Premier League table, with the Blues still unbeaten after six matches.

Cech believes that a string of new signings is helping Roberto Di Matteo's side change their style to great effect.

The Czech international told FIFA.com: "Our style has evolved and we're trying to bring more dynamism to our attacking moves thanks to the talented players we have further forward.

"So far, Hazard's arrival has done us a lot of good. He's quickly built an understanding with the players around him, like Juan Mata and Oscar, and it's really pleasing to see a player come in from another league and adapt so quickly.

"As for Oscar, I'm very happy for him because it's not easy to just show up here from Brazil, where the championship is completely different.

"His double against Juventus showed that he fully deserves his place here and it'll give him lots of confidence for the future."

Chelsea continue the defence of their Champions League title in midweek with a trip to Danish champions FC Nordsjaelland.
